Manuel Uribe used to hold the record of World’s Heaviest Man, weighing in at 1,235 pounds. That title has held him back more than anyone could ever imagine. He has been bedridden since 2002, completely dependent on relatives and close friends for food and personal hygiene. Yesterday, according to Mexican news reports, Uribe left his home in San Nicholas de Los Garza, Mexico for the first time in five years after losing 395 pounds off his large frame. Friends wheeled him out of his home on his bed where he was greeted by neighbors and hoards of media.
What’s so remarkable about Uribe’s weight loss is that he is dropping pounds by following a fad diet. He is working with Mexican doctors and nutritionists to lose an incredible 1,000 pounds by following The Zone Diet. Uribe serves as an inspiration to other individuals who suffer from obesity, proving that surgery is not the only way shed fat and return to a normal lifestyle. He is losing weight and improving his health along the way.
At the same time Uribe is using his experience to help others. When he regains his mobility he plans to start a foundation to help others who suffer from obesity to live healthier lifestyles and gain access to medical services.
